WebIt sets where physical memory begins and ends for the node, allocates a bitmap representing the pages and sets all pages as reserved initially. 1020register_bootmem_low_pages () reads the e820 map and calls free_bootmem () (See Section E.3.1) for all usable pages in the running system. WebBootmem. (mostly stolen from Mel Gorman’s “Understanding the Linux Virtual Memory Manager” book) Bootmem is a boot-time physical memory allocator and configurator.
